2004 monte carlo ss random stall
ok my moms monte just developed this problem. it will start and run fine still has good power,if you drove it you would think nothing is wrong with it until it just dies no sttuter or jerk or anything it just stops running like you shut the car off.but it does start right back up and run normal and you could go 100ft or 30mi before it dies again. i replaced the crankshaft position sensor allready and it did nothing. i thought with this new computer controlled B.S. it would throw a code but none are present.any thoughts?

Ensure the wiring to the crank sensor isn't damaged. If that's not it, check your ground by the ICM. If all that is good, your ICM (Ignition Control Module) is probably going bad.
